During the evening of october 16, 2019 while driving on interstate highway 84 near the eagle road exit 46 with my 5 year old grandson, my jeep had a catastrophic electrical failure. i could not get the turn signals, headlights, windshield wipers, or horn to work. later i learned that at least the drivers air bag was also inoperable. the next morning my local jeep dealer (larry h miller, boise, id) diagnosed the problem as a failure of the 'clock spring' the service manager called me and said that due to the ongoing recall of certain right hand drive jeep wranglers (nhtsa campaign numbers:16v288000, 13v176000, and 11v528000, all involving the clock spring) a new, redesigned, clock spring is not available for non-recalled vehicles. he to install at my epense a new clock spring, but of the old design, which would eventually fail.

On the 2011 jeep wrangler (lhd) dashboard, the airbag warning light flashes on every other minute with a chime, an indication that there is something malfunctioning or interfering with the vehicle's airbags.this has been a recurring issue and concern for many jeep wrangler (lhd) owners, including myself, and has been shown time and time again to be caused by a faulty clockspring within the vehicle's steering wheel. this faulty clockspring is the culprit for potential airbag failure in the 2011 jeep wrangler (lhd) during an accident or premature deployment when simply driving around. daimler chrysler has issued a letter stating that some jeeps may have a recall on this safety concern of their faulty clockspring that can cause failure of the vehicle's airbags from properly deploying. i contacted the dealership and they stated that i do not have a recall for this issue.

My airbag warning light has been randomly coming on while driving. i researched the topic to find out that the clockspring was often the cause of this. i filled out a complaint mentioning the clockspring. shortly after, and perhaps coincidentally, i received notice from chrysler that my clockspring warranty had been extended to 15 years/unlimited miles. i took the wrangler into the dealer and diagnostics suggested they needed to change the orc (occupant restraint controller) module. i asked them to hold off on the repair and i would do some research. that is my current status.

Clock spring recall s33 does not cover jeep wrangler 2011 left hand drive models! warning this is unsafe and a 10 on the oem's dfmea! unfair. this 2011 clock spring failure causes airbag light and same code as the 2007 - 2010 and 2011 right drive recalls. i have dealer repair receipts to prove. why aren't the left hand 2011 jeep jk wranglers included in this safety recall? keep all your documentation and report to fca and to nhtsa if you have same issue to get reimbursement when they do recall the left hand model.
